L'importance de comprendre le CSS pour prévenir les problèmes de mise en page
L'un des problèmes les plus courants en développement web est la rupture de mise en page.
Par exemple, si vous utilisez des propriétés comme float, flex ou position sans les comprendre pleinement, vous risquez de ne pas obtenir le layout souhaité, avec des éléments qui se chevauchent ou disparaissent de manière inattendue.
Une compréhension systématique des fondamentaux du CSS permet d'identifier rapidement les causes et d'apporter des corrections appropriées.
Les bases du CSS restent essentielles à l'ère de l'IA
Bien que les assistants de codage IA aient évolué, les causes des problèmes de layout restent difficiles à verbaliser pour les IA.
Comprendre le fonctionnement du CSS permet d'évaluer correctement les suggestions de l'IA et de faire les corrections nécessaires manuellement.
Design responsive et approche mobile-first
Autrefois, on créait des versions séparées pour PC et mobile, ce qui générait des efforts de maintenance doublés.
Le design responsive moderne permet de gérer tous les appareils avec un seul fichier CSS, optimisant radicalement la gestion des mises à jour.
L'approche mobile-first, qui base le style sur les mobiles avant de l'adapter aux grands écrans, est désormais incontournable.
UI/UX et le potentiel des animations CSS
Sur les petits écrans mobiles, une UI/UX soignée est cruciale. Maîtriser le CSS permet de créer des designs à la fois beaux et fonctionnels dans un espace limité.
Les animations CSS offrent également des possibilités étendues pour des expériences utilisateur fluides et agréables.
L'importance de continuer à apprendre le CSS
Le CSS n'est pas qu'un langage de décoration - il influence profondément la fonctionnalité, l'identité et l'expérience utilisateur d'un site web.
Une maîtrise systématique du CSS permet un contrôle précis des layouts et des designs sophistiqués, élargissant considérablement vos capacités en développement web.
Approfondissez sans cesse vos connaissances, des bases aux techniques avancées, pour créer des sites web toujours meilleurs.